Success in the transition from higher education to work is influenced by a multiplicity of factors associated with the individual, his/her context, as well as their interaction. The Transition-to-Work Social Cognitive Model conceptually organizes the complexity of this transition and guides its research. The present study aims to evaluate if transition-to-work self-efficacy predicts the success obtained in this transition, one year after obtaining a bachelor degree. The results show the predictive potential of self-efficacy in relation to satisfaction with the academic-professional course and the work, which highlights the pertinence of psychoeducational interventions aimed at developing self-efficacy in the transition to work of students from higher education institutions.
